What should you look for when viewing a student project?
Don't just look at whether the website looks beautiful.
Ask yourself:
1. What problem does the project solve?
A good project starts with a problem.
It could be a business problem, an automation problem, a security problem, or simply an idea that the student wanted to turn into a working product.
2. What technologies were used?
Look beyond the project name.
Check the technologies behind it.
Frontend.
Backend.
Database.
APIs.
Authentication.
Deployment.
Security.
The technology stack can tell you a lot about the depth of the project.
3. Can the student explain their decisions?
This is where a project becomes more valuable than a certificate.
A developer should be able to explain:
Why did you choose this technology?
How does your backend communicate with your frontend?
How is the data stored?
What happens when something goes wrong?
How did you secure it?
These questions reveal whether someone simply followed a tutorial or actually understood what they were building.
